In Scenarios Where Might Makes Right: A Dive into Brute Force Algorithms

Brute force algorithms are the powerhouses of the computational world. They're basic in concept: try every possible combination until you find the solution. Imagine a secured treasure chest, and your brute force algorithm is rigidly trying every key until it unlocks the chest. While this method might seem inefficient, it's surprisingly robust for certain challenges. In fact, brute force algorithms have been instrumental in decrypting complex codes and unveiling patterns that elude more sophisticated approaches.

However, brute force algorithms come with a trade-off. Their processing complexity often increases exponentially as the magnitude of the problem expands. This means that for large problems, brute force algorithms can become extremely slow. Nevertheless, in situations where the problem size is manageable, or when speed is secondary, brute force algorithms remain a powerful tool in the developer's arsenal.

Pure Computation Power: Brute Force

Brute force strategies, in the realm of computation, often emerge as a straightforward yet surprisingly effective method for solving problems. This computational weapon relies on sheer exhaustion to uncover the optimal solution. By rigorously examining every possible combination, brute force guarantee a definitive answer, even if it requires an inordinate amount of time.

  • Imagine a lock with countless combinations. Brute force would involve trying every single combination until the lock unlocks.
  • While undeniably powerful, brute force can be resource-demanding, especially for problems with a vast solution space.
  • Nevertheless, brute force remains a relevant tool in certain scenarios, particularly when other methods prove infeasible.
